Kabobs Inc is recalling MINI DEEP DISH MUSHROOM PIZZA, 200 CT, Prepared by: Kabobs, 54234 North Lake Dr. Lake City, GA 30260 due to Product was manufactured with flour recalled due to E. coli O121 contamination.. Reason for Recall
As stated by FDA
Product was manufactured with flour recalled due to E. coli O121 contamination.
Recommended Action
Per FDA guidance
Consumers should stop using the product and contact the recalling firm or return it to the place of purchase.
